Chào Thầy!
Thầy cho em hỏi đoạn code yêu cầu nhập password khi active một sheet đang ẩn được viết như thế nào ạ!
Chào bạn, ý của bạn đang nói đến pass sheets đúng không? hay như thế nào?
vâng,
ví dụ file có 2 sheet, sheet 2 ẩn hết nội dung (đặt pass)
yêu cầu là: code để gán assign macro khi nhấp vào nút gán assign macro đó thì hiện hộp thông báo yêu cầu nhập pass ok thì mở sheet 2, không thì hiện thông báo sai pass.
Mong thầy giúp đỡ ạ!
Em cảm ơn thầy!
Chào bạn bạn thử code sau nhé:
Option Explicit
Sub checksheethide()
On Error Resume Next
Dim sht As Worksheet
If Sheet1.Visible = xlSheetHidden Then
Dim str As String
str = InputBox("Input Box", "Nhap mat khau")
Sheet1.Protect , str
If Sheet1.ProtectContents = True Then
MsgBox "sai mat khau"
Exit Sub
Else
Sheet1.Visible = xlSheetVisible
End If
Else
MsgBox "khong mo"
End If
End Sub
https://drive.google.com/file/d/1fwZc...
Em làm file test năng lực nhân viên. Sheet A là bài test, Sheet B là hiển thị kết quả cùng đáp án.
Mong thầy giúp em với yêu cầu:
Khi nhân viên thi xong, quản lý nhấp chuột vào button xem kết quả và phải nhập mật khẩu đúng thì mới xem được kết quả bài thi [Để tránh nhân viên gian lận ạ]
tạm thời lấy mật khẩu là: 123 thầy nhé
Em cảm ơn thầy!
Chào bạn, bạn cho gitiho xin ultraview vào giờ hành chính nhé.
Em Chào Thầy!
Em viết file để sử dụng nhưng đang bị mắc phần thông báo.
Tức là trước khi thực thi phần in e muốn hiện thông báo tùy chọn OK -thì in, Cancel - thì hủy.
Thầy xem Code và chỉnh sửa lại dùm em nhé ạ!
Em cảm ơn thầy!
Chào bạn bạn sử dụng msgbox như sau nhé:
Dim hoi As VbMsgBoxResult
hoi = MsgBox ""Ban co muon in khong?", vbYesNo, "Thông báo")
If hoi = vbYes Then
//code thuc hiện in
end if
Em cám ơn thầy!
Em làm được rồi ạ!
Cảm ơn bạn đã đồng hành cùng gitiho, chúc bạn học tốt.
Em chào Thầy!
Hiện em đang cho các bạn nhân viên thực hiện bài test năng lực. số lượng bài test rất nhiều. Em muốn tạo một file để tổng hợp lại kết quả mỗi lần test nhưng không biết trong phạm vi VBA có thực hiện được không?
Em nhờ thầy xem qua file ở đường link phía dưới với yêu cầu cụ thể trong file List Tong Hop.
https://drive.google.com/drive/folder...
Em rất mong nhận được sự chỉ dạy từ thầy!
Em cảm ơn thầy!
Chào bạn, bạn cho gitiho xin quyền truy cập nhé.
Dạ, em sơ xuất quá, em đã thay đổi quyền truy cập rồi ạ!
Chào bạn phần này bạn cần làm 2 bước, 1 là đưa dữ liệu vào sheets tổng hợp cái này bạn xem chương 10.
Rồi tiêp tục dùng dùng vòng lặp để tổng hợp dữ liệu theo list tổng hợp đó
vâng, em cám ơn thầy!
Chúc bạn học tốt cùng gitiho
Em chào thầy!
Em có làm theo hướng dẫn của thầy tuy nhiên do kiến thức chưa đủ nên không ra được kết quả, do yêu cầu công việc cần gấp nên nếu được em nhờ thầy hướng dẫn chi tiết em phần này với nhé!
https://drive.google.com/drive/folder...
Em cảm ơn thầy rất nhiều!